FIFA World Cup 2026: USMNT Beats Bosnia-Herzegovina 2-0 to Reach Round of 16

The USA defeated Bosnia and Herzegovina 2-0 in the round of 32 at the San Francisco Bay Area Stadium. Match was absolutely sensational, full of excellent moves and aggressive attacks. US goalkeeper Matt Freese saved a beautiful inswinger, preventing Bosnia and Herzegovina from taking an early lead. 

Both teams poured all of their energy into winning the game.

The USA scored their first goal just before the end of first half through Folarin BALOGUN. 

The second half of the game began with renewed energy. Bosnia and Herzegovina fought for a comeback while the US continued their attacks to extend their lead. However, the US faced a major setback when Folarin Balogun was sent off with a red card. Despite the tough situation, the US team managed the pressure. They continued attacks and extended their lead through Malik Tillman, who scored in the 82nd minute of the game via a free kick just outside the penalty area.
